Abstract

Model studies have shown the advantage of acquiring seismic data parallel to the main tectonic directions or to lithological variations . For instance, for an imaging problem below a fault, if the acquisition is orthogonal to the fault plane, the seismic ray paths are crossing the fault and will be affected if the acquisition is parallel to the fault plane, all the-ray paths are in the same panel and wil] not be distorted . In the Jatter case, we therefore have better conditions for applying traditional processing tools and, more especially, for applying Normai (hyperbolic) Move Out .
